Chapter 4 in the Outcome Mapping (OM) manual describes outcome and performance monitoring and leads users / facilitators through several exercises coinciding with steps 8 through 11 of the OM framework. The following guiding notes draw from the ideas discussed in “Considerations for learning-oriented M and E with Outcome Mapping”, into three practical exercises that could be used as a complement to the OM manual. These notes, as well as the brief, are based on the premise that learning-oriented monitoring and evaluation should start with identifying the purpose for assessment based on users and uses, as well as the existing spaces for sharing, debate and decision-making that are key for learning, then deciding which data to collect.
